3D imaging on the Alpha 700
Loreo has released an Alpha-mount 3D lens unit, and Jeff Wulf, an early tester, has put up a galleries of 3D shots taken using it:
http://picasaweb.google.com/pastorjeff/Loreo3DMacroLens
http://picasaweb.google.co.uk/pastorjef ... WLoreoLens
Here is the product information:
http://www.loreo.com/pages/products/lor ... gital.html
It is possible for most people to view these stereograms by making a 6 x 4" inch or smaller print, and using a pair of reading glasses (you have to learn to migrate your vision and look 'through' the print). I found the image shown on my computer screen too large for direct viewing this way. The gap between corresponding points on the images should not be more than 75mm/3 inches and is better at 65mm.

Re: 3D imaging on the Alpha 700
I have done 3D photos in the past, so I've been keeping my eye out for Loreo to make this lens optimized for APS-C size. There aren't many options.
One option is to just move the camera laterally. This only works if you can keep things really straight (or fix any tilting in software after-the-fact). That can be fixed with a gadget that is a slider that mounts to a tripod. Since I don't like carrying tripods, I am not a fan of this approach. Plus things that are in movement won't be captured correctly. But it's a start to see if the idea is appealing to you.
Having two cameras fired simultaneously would be ideal IQ, but now you're talking about a silly amount of bulk and cost.
So, I guess it comes down to, is the novelty of 3D enough to overcome what is probably not an ideal lens? How is the IQ?
I find it pretty easy to see 3D images if you swap them and use the cross-eyed method. Of course, I'd prefer just using a dedicated viewer with prints...
(I actually have a dedicated 3D film camera that takes 4 images simultaneously! This is really the awesome way to do it, but it's expensive to have a lenticular print made, and really difficult to do yourself, even with software. And I don't think the IQ is as good as I'd like, although, part of that is the processing needed... But the result is a print that needs no special viewer.)

Re: 3D imaging on the Alpha 700
DK may well correct me, but I seem to remember quite some time ago an article in Minolta World by someone who conjoined a pair of (I think) X300's to produce stereo images.
Stereo images can look quite spectacular when projected (you need special projectors, polarising projector lenses and spectacles, and mounts). You can adjust the positioning so that the image appears to be suspended in mid air in front of the projection screen - disconcerting when a macro image of a tiny bug is transformed to appear six foot long and positioned just above the front row of the audience!

Re: 3D imaging on the Alpha 700
Your memory is good. That was David Burder, one of the world's leading professional 3D photographers today, with a Siamese twinned pair of X-700s (I think, not 300s). I will try to find the story and the photo. Because I was one of Nimslo's pro 3D photographers from 1978-1981 in the UK, using both the rail and the multilens custom built cameras, David who then worked for British Oxygen commissioned some industrial shots from me. He was impressed by the XE-1 kit I was using, and later came on the club's 1981(?)-2 trip to Tunisia, where although paying for the trip, he proved a great guide and help to all the party. He later built his conjoined X-700 with a pair of 35-70mm zooms which focused together and aperture adjusted together, synchronised by gears mounted on the rings.
He still sends me his 3D Christmas card every year.
